网络爬虫的数据采集方法有哪些?

 我来答
王维吃黄桃
2023-02-19 · 我是王维吃黄桃,欢迎大家提问,hhhhh
王维吃黄桃
采纳数:3 获赞数:13

向TA提问 私信TA
展开全部
  1. 基于HTTP协议的数据采集:HTTP协议是Web应用程序的基础协议,网络爬虫可以模拟HTTP协议的请求和响应,从而获取Web页面的HTML、CSS、JavaScript、图片等资源,并解析页面中的数据。

  2. 基于API接口的数据采集:许多网站提供API接口来提供数据访问服务,网络爬虫可以通过调用API接口获取数据。与直接采集Web页面相比,通过API接口获取数据更为高效和稳定。

  3. 基于无头浏览器的数据采集:无头浏览器是一种无界面的浏览器,它可以模拟用户在浏览器中的行为,包括页面加载、点击事件等。网络爬虫可以使用无头浏览器来模拟用户在Web页面中的操作,以获取数据。

  4. 基于文本分析的数据采集:有些数据存在于文本中,网络爬虫可以使用自然语言处理技术来分析文本数据,提取出需要的信息。例如,网络爬虫可以使用文本分类、实体识别等技术来分析新闻文章,提取出其中的关键信息。

  5. 基于机器学习的数据采集:对于一些复杂的数据采集任务,网络爬虫可以使用机器学习技术来构建模型,自动识别和采集目标数据。例如,可以使用机器学习模型来识别图片中的物体或文字,或者使用自然语言处理模型来提取文本信息。

  6. 总之,网络爬虫的数据采集方法多种多样,不同的采集任务需要选择不同的方法来实现。

柚鸥ASO
2024-03-16 广告
「柚鸥ASO」在ASO这块就做的蛮不错的,一直专注于应用商店优化,因为专注所以专业;专注应用商店下载量优化、评分优化、关键词排名优化、关键词覆盖、产品权重提升等等整体方案优化服务柚鸥网络-全球ASO优化服务商专注ASO优化已11年!(效果说... 点击进入详情页
本回答由柚鸥ASO提供
数阔八爪鱼采集器丨RPA机器人
2023-07-24 · 前往八爪鱼RPA应用市场,免费获取机器人
数阔八爪鱼采集器丨RPA机器人
向TA提问
展开全部
网络爬虫的数据采集方法有多种,包括但不限于以下几种:1. 静态网页采集:通过发送HTTP请求获取网页的HTML源码,然后使用解析库(如BeautifulSoup)解析HTML,提取所需的数据。2. 动态网页采集:对于使用JavaScript动态加载数据的网页,可以使用无头浏览器(如Selenium)模拟浏览器行为,获取完整的渲染后的网页内容。3. API接口采集:一些网站提供了API接口,可以直接通过发送HTTP请求获取数据,通常返回的是结构化的数据(如JSON格式)。4. RSS订阅采集:一些网站提供了RSS订阅功能,可以通过订阅RSS源获取更新的内容。5. 数据库采集:一些网站将数据存储在数据库中,可以通过连接数据库并执行SQL查询语句获取数据。八爪鱼采集器是一款功能全面、操作简单、适用范围广泛的互联网数据采集器。无论是静态网页采集、动态网页采集还是API接口采集,八爪鱼采集器都可以帮助您快速获取所需的数据。了解更多八爪鱼采集器的功能与合作案例,请前往官网了解更多详细信息。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式